SIR DOUGLAS HAIG'S REPORT

(AUS. AND N.Z. CABLB ASSN. AND REUTER.) (Received August 18, 2.30 p.m.) LONDON, 17th August. Sir Douglas Haig reports: The enemy made two counter-attacks last night against our new positions east of Loos in the direction of Cite St. Auguste. His second attempt pressed the line back slightly at some points, but our counterattack restored the positions. We repulsed a further counter-attack. Artillery activity is mutual east of Ypres.
